Abstract
INTRODUCTION: Approximately 15 to 30% of patients undergoing percutaneous coronary intervention (PCI) will require repeated revascularization. There is an ongoing debate concerning the impact of prior PCI on subsequent coronary artery bypass graft (CABG) surgery. This study sought to compare immediate post-CABG complications between patients with and without previous coronary stenting.Entities:
